T520 VPU is a 1999 Kawasaki ZR-7 in Blue with a 738c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.

Across all 1999 Kawasaki ZR-7 models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.9% with a typical mileage of 21,694 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Kawasaki ZR-7 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 290 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T520 VPU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Kawasaki ZR-7 typ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 27 years old, this Kawasaki ZR-7 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
